Output d3053e7e29639e9d37c4a38051b8c585ab11c4c4ccb31a8088d3e4f264925cfe:0

value
379220783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72640c1824a798811fe2894487ecf1307832f1b5 OP_EQUAL
address
3C7ropKqA36Mf8dwZ9B1oLREnVAXpZUCUh
transaction
d3053e7e29639e9d37c4a38051b8c585ab11c4c4ccb31a8088d3e4f264925cfe
spent
true